Unique – Meaning, Definition, Synonyms and Antonyms
Unique is used as a “Adjective” in the English grammar.
Meaning:
Unique means to Being the only one of its kind.
Definition:
Something unique possesses rare qualities or characteristics. Uniqueness is often valued for its creativity and exclusivity.
Example Sentences:
- This painting has a Unique color blend.
- He shared a Unique and creative idea.
- The island offers a Unique travel experience.
Unique Synonyms:
- Distinctive
- Exceptional
- Unparalleled
- Incomparable
Unique Antonyms:
- Common
- Ordinary
- Typical
- Standard
- Conventional
